Transaction 2ece31a72022559189915ef59b59415af8630d4e342a3e4628fee182954b5bc3

block
b33eb3059d9b770c2011966e9ab7cf5e0a91bc6c02615e6d5b7b9340bee47119

1 Input

20 Outputs